UPVC window lock repair

uPVC windows are a popular option for new homes and renovations. These windows offer many benefits, such as durability, ease of maintenance, and energy efficiency. These windows are BPAand phthalate-free, making them safe for children. They are also rustproof and do not require varnishing or painting. They will not be warped, rot, or leak, and are easy to clean. Despite their durability and ease in maintenance, uPVC can sometimes develop problems that require attention from a professional. This could be a draughty window, a broken handle, or a faulty lock.

uPVC window and door locks may become damaged over the years because of wear and tear or accidental damage. This makes them less effective and vulnerable to break-ins. This is why it's crucial to fix these components as soon as possible. You can employ an expert in double-glazing in your area to perform this. This kind of specialist has been trained to perform a wide range of repairs and upgrades for uPVC windows and doors. They can also recommend other security products, such as door viewers, letterbox guards and door chains.

A gap between the sash's frame and the frame may be the reason for your windows that are not closing properly. This can lead to draughts, but it can also cause dampness and water damage. You can test this by placing some paper between the sash frame and the sash to see if the sash can be shut.

To repair this, you'll need to break the seal around the frame and sash. The next step is to remove the locking mechanism from its location within the frame. This will require the assistance of a tool, such as a flat screwdriver and a torch to access it. Once you have removed the gearbox, you'll need to replace it with a brand new one with the same type and size.

You can also find a local Tasker to help you fix your uPVC window locks. They will have all the tools required for the job and will carry them with them. They are familiar with the various types of uPVC windows and will be able to recognize yours via phone. They can identify the issue quickly and will give you a price on the repair work.

Repair window frames made of UPVC

If your uPVC windows are damaged, have cracks, holes, or an unsound window seal It is crucial to repair them right away. These issues can cause the glass of your windows to become cloudy and may also lead water leaks. In addition, the frame damage can lower the insulation value of your home and result in more expensive energy bills. Most of these problems are easily repaired by an expert or a DIY repair.

UPVC window repairs are less expensive than replacing the entire unit, however in some cases it is better to replace the entire unit. This is especially true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of a UPVC replacement window is determined by a variety of factors, such as the kind of material used and the amount of labor involved. A full replacement can cost between $100 and $1000 for a window. The price will differ depending on the extent of the damage and whether or whether the window needs to be replaced.

Cleaning UPVC windows is essential to prevent dirt and moisture buildup. This will help you avoid costly repairs down the road. You should do this at least twice a year. You may also apply WD-40 to grease the moving parts of your UPVC window. Before cleaning the frame, it's best to get rid of any dust or cobwebs with a soft bristle brush. You can sand off any scratches on the frames in order to make them look brand new.

Window frames made from wood are susceptible to rot and damage over time. The frames can also dry out and swell due to heat and sun and heat, which causes them break or split. In general, wooden frames require more frequent repairs than UPVC or fiberglass models. Fortunately, these issues are easily fixed with simple fixes and are often less expensive than a full replacement.

UPVC frames are a fantastic alternative for homeowners, since they provide a range of advantages over wood frames. UPVC windows are durable, easy-to-maintain, and aesthetically pleasing. It is also eco friendly and helps to keep energy costs low. To cut down on the expense of upvc window repairs near me repair, you can tackle minor issues with the beading and the sill. You can also make the frames look more attractive by painting or staining them.

Replacement UPVC window frames

UPVC windows are a fantastic option for homeowners due their durability, low maintenance requirements, and excellent insulation properties. They are susceptible to a variety of issues that require professional repair. Some of the most common issues are leaks or cracked window seals, window sills and sash issues, as well as broken handles and hinges. These issues can impact the appearance and function of your home if they are not addressed quickly. UPVC window specialists can resolve these issues, and ensure that your uPVC Windows are safe and functional.

During the inspection, your expert will be in a position to determine any areas of concern and give you advice on what is the most appropriate course of action for your situation. You will also receive a complete quote for any necessary repairs. Repairing UPVC will usually involve removing the sash, cleaning the jambs and sills and replacing old sealants. The cost of this service will vary according to the type of window as well as its condition.

A leaky UPVC window can be caused by a variety of factors such as weather conditions, and general wear and wear and tear. These elements can cause the UPVC window to warp or become damaged. It can be costly to repair this damage, so consult a professional to do it.

Water condensation between the glass panes is a different issue with double-glazed UPVC Windows. This can occur when the frames of the windows aren't properly fitted or if the nail fins have become loose and are not providing a good seal. A uPVC repair specialist will replace the seals and make sure that the window is well sealed to prevent drafts and increase energy efficiency.

UPVC window repairs are a low-cost and efficient method of keeping your home warm during winter and cool in summer. They can also increase the appearance of your home. It is crucial to address any problems with your UPVC window as promptly as you can. This will stop your UPVC from becoming damaged or rotting, and will also save you money in the long term.
